Hyderabad: Elon Musk launched his flagship artificial intelligence chatbot, Grok 3 AI, on Monday, calling it the “smartest AI on Earth.”
Grok 3 has been rolled out for Premium+ subscribers on X. Users need to update their X app to access the new features. A new subscription plan called SuperGrok will soon be available for users on the Grok mobile app and Grok.com website.
What Does the AI Tool Do?
Grok 3 AI, a large language model (LLM), utilizes over 10 times the computing power of Grok 2, significantly enhancing its reasoning abilities. Reports suggest that the latest LLM outperforms almost all of its rivals in coding, mathematics, and science.
The AI offers access to two buttons with different functionalities, designed to improve task efficiency:
- The “Think” button, which relies on a mini model of Grok 3, handles simpler tasks and queries.
- The “Big Brain” button, powered by Grok 3, is designed to solve more complex queries.
According to xAI, Grok 3 AI has outperformed rival models, including OpenAI’s GPT-4 Turbo Mini, Google’s Gemini 2 Flash, and DeepSeek’s R1, in reasoning tests based on a mathematics benchmark called AIME 2025.
Additionally, the AI tool introduces an agentic feature called DeepSearch, which enables users to conduct comprehensive analyses and generate reports.
Meanwhile, Elon Musk announced in a post on X that the launch of voice mode for Grok 3 will be delayed by a week, as it is still “a little patchy.”
